How to make money from your blog: A guide to monetizing your blog and earning an income from it.




It’s no secret that many bloggers are looking to monetize their blogs in some way, shape, or form. Whether it’s through affiliate marketing, selling products and services, or some other form of passive income, there are many ways to turn your blog into a money-making machine.

One of the most popular ways to monetize a blog is through advertising. You can sign up for ad networks like Google Adsense or Media.net, or work with brands directly to place ads on your site. This can be a great way to earn some extra cash, but it’s important to remember that too many ads can hurt the user experience and turn readers off from your site.

Another popular way to make money from your blog is through affiliate marketing. This is where you promote products and services on your site and earn a commission when someone clicks on your affiliate link and makes a purchase. This can be a great way to earn some passive income, but again, it’s important not to overdo it and clutter your site with too many ads and affiliate links.

Finally, another great way to monetize your blog is by selling products and services directly on your site. This could be anything from ebooks and courses to physical products like clothing or home goods. If you have something of value to sell, there’s no reason why you can’t sell it directly on your blog!

So there you have it – a few of the most popular ways to monetize your blog and start earning an income from it. Just remember that whatever route you decide to go down, quality content should always come first!

How to guest post on other blogs: A guide to guest posting on other blogs in order to promote your own.



Guest posting is a great way to promote your blog and attract readers. It involves writing a blog post for another blog in exchange for a link back to your own blog.

The key to guest posting successfully is to find blogs that are relevant to your niche and that have a large enough audience that your post will be seen by many people. Once you have found such a blog, you need to reach out to the owner or editor and pitch them your idea for a post.

If they accept your pitch, then you can write the post and submit it to them. Once it is published, make sure to promote it on social media and other channels so that people can see it and click through to your own blog.

Guest posting is a great way to get traffic to your blog and build relationships with other bloggers in your niche. Follow the tips above and start guest posting today!

How to keep your blog going: A guide to keeping your blog active and updated.



It can be really easy to start a blog and then let it fall by the wayside, especially if you’re not seeing the results you’d hoped for. Trust us, we’ve been there! But if you’re Blogging with the intention of making money online, then it’s important to make sure that your blog is active and updated on a regular basis. Not only will this help draw in readers, but it will also show potential advertisers that your site is alive and well. So how do you keep your blog going? Here are a few tips:

1) Plan ahead: 

One of the best ways to make sure that your blog stays active is to plan ahead. Sit down and map out a schedule of posts for the next month or so. This will give you a roadmap to follow and will help to prevent those dreaded blogger’s block moments.

2) Set aside some time each week: 

Dedicating even just an hour or two each week to blogging can make a big difference. Use this time to brainstorm new ideas, write posts, or network with other bloggers.

3) Find some inspiration: 

When you feel like you’re in a rut, it can be helpful to find some inspiration from other bloggers. Check out sites like Alltop or Bloglovin’ which feature lists of popular blogs in specific categories. Or, follow some of your favorite bloggers on social media and see what kinds of content they’re sharing.

4) Take advantage of tools: 

There are lots of great tools out there that can make blogging easier and more efficient. For example, using a platform like WordPress can help you save time by automating some of the more tedious tasks associated with blogging (like formatting your posts). And there are tons of great plugins available that can add features and functionality to your site (like social media buttons or contact forms).

5) Keep it fresh: 

One final piece of advice is to try and mix things up once in a while on your blog. If you always write about the same topics, your readers might get bored after a while. So switch things up every now and then by writing about new topics, guest posting on other blogs, or hosting giveaways/contests. By keeping things fresh, you’ll keep people coming back for more!
